Essential ingredients and tools for crafting Alcohol-Free Cocktails

After we’ve examined the increasing appeal and popularity of alcohol-free cocktails in the previous section, we’re ready to get our hands dirty and get into the world of mixology. The art of making exquisite alcohol-free cocktails requires good ingredients and equipment which is why in this section we’ll cover the most essential tools that any aspiring mixologist must have available.


1. The Basic Ingredients


Fruit Juices

Fruit juices make up the main ingredient of many alcohol-free cocktails. Citrus juices like orange, lime, and lemon are able to provide that zesty kick. juices such as pineapple, cranberry, and pomegranate add depth and sweetness. Make sure you have a selection of juices from fresh fruits in your fridge.


Sweeteners and syrups

For balance and to make the syrups sweeter, syrups like basic syrups, honey syrup, and grenadine play a vital role. Also, you can experiment with flavor-infused syrups such as vanilla or lavender to make your own unique blend.


Herbs and Spices

Fresh herbs like mint, basil and rosemary can add a touch of flavor to your cocktails with aromatic complexity. Spices such as cinnamon, cloves and nutmeg make excellent ingredients to create warm and comforting drinks that are alcohol-free.


Soda Water as well Tonic Water

These mixers with carbonated ingredients provide the effervescence typical of many drinks. Soda water can be a flexible base for various drinks, while tonic water is essential to make classic drinks like cocktails like Virgin G&T.


Astringents as well as Aromatics

Bitters give depth and variety to cocktails that are alcohol-free. There are options such as Angostura bitters or aromatic bitters could transform an unassuming drink into elegant creation.


2. Fresh Ingredients


Fresh Fruits and Berries

Garnishing your cocktails with fresh fruit and berries not just improves the look of your cocktails but also provides the drinks with natural flavors. The citrus, lemons, strawberries and blueberries are a popular choices.


Herbs as well Edible Flowers

Fresh herbs like basil, mint and thyme are placed in a muddle or as garnishes for adding aroma to your drink. The edible flowers such as pansies and violets will make your drinks very Instagram-worthy.


Citrus Zest

The zest of citrus fruits (peel without pith) can be used to garnish or to rim glasses with cocktail ice. It will add a blast of citrus aroma and flavor to your cocktails.


3. Specialized Tools


Cocktail Shaker

The cocktail shaker is essential to mix and chill your ingredients. It’s flexible and can be used to shake or stirring, depending on the cocktail.


Muddler

This tool is great for crushing herbs gently, fruits, or sugar cubes for releasing their flavours. It’s crucial for the creation of mojitos and similar cocktails.


Jiggers or other Measuring Instruments

Accurate measurements are essential in mixing. A measuring tool or jigger will ensure your cocktails remain uniform and balanced.


Strainer

A strainer can be helpful in straining out herbs and ice as you pour your drinks into glasses. It makes sure that your drink is smooth and uncluttered drink.


Citrus Juicer and Zester

If you are making cocktails that require freshly-cut citrus zest or juice dedicated juicers and zesters can provide efficiency and precision.


4. Glassware and presentation


Cocktail Glasses

Consider investing in a variety of cocktail glasses, including highball, rocks, and coupe glasses. The different cocktails shine in various types of glassware.


Bar Spoons and Stirrers

Long-handled spoons for bar use are used for stirring cocktails, while stirrers with decorative end can double as tools for garnishing.


Ice Cube Trays as well as Molds

You should consider investing in unique ice molds and cubes that add a visual twist to your cocktails, such as spherical glass ice for cocktails that are whiskey-based.

1. Virgin Mojito


  • Ingredients:

    • 2 oz (60 ml) fresh lime juice
    • 2 teaspoons sugar
    • A few mint leaves
    • Soda water
    • Ice cubes

  • Instructions:

    1. With a drink, mix the sugar and mint leaves in order to release the mint’s aroma.
    2. Mix in the lime juice and Ice cubes.
    3. Add soda water and gently stir.
    4. Garnish with a few sprigs of rosemary and an lime wheel.

The Virgin Mojito is a classic option for people who are looking for an energizing and refreshing drink with a touch of sweetness. It’s the perfect drink to quench thirst on an afternoon of sunshine.


2. Shirley Temple


  • Ingredients:

    • 4 oz (120 ml) ginger ale
    • 2 oz (60 ml) grenadine syrup
    • A maraschino cherry
    • Ice cubes

  • Instructions:

    1. Make sure to fill a glass with ice cubes.
    2. Pour in the ginger ale and grenadine syrup.
    3. Stir gently to mix.
    4. Garnish with a maraschino cherry.

Shirley Temple Shirley Temple is a delightful and refreshing concoction that is loved by both adults and kids. Its sweet and refreshing flavors make it an ideal drink for any occasion.


3. Virgin PiA+-a Colada


  • Ingredients:

    • 2 oz (60 ml) pineapple juice
    • 2 oz (60 ml) coconut cream
    • 1 oz (30 ml) coconut milk
    • 1 cup of crushed Ice
    • Pineapple wedge and maraschino cherry to garnish

  • Instructions:

    1. In a blender, blend the juice of a pineapple and coconut cream, coconut milk, with crushed ice.
    2. Blend until the mixture is silky and smooth and.
    3. Pour the drink into glasses that are chilled.
    4. Garnish with a slice of pineapple and maraschino cherry.

Escape to an exotic paradise with this luscious Virgin PiA+-a Colada. It’s sweet, tangy, and absolutely delicious.


4. Virgin Mary (Virgin Bloody Mary)


  • Ingredients:

    • 4 oz (120 ml) tomato juice
    • 1/2 oz (15 ml) fresh lemon juice
    • A little black pepper
    • A dash (or two) of hot sauce (adjust according to your preference)
    • A celery stick and lemon wedge for garnish
    • Ice cubes

  • Instructions:

    1. Place ice cubes in a glass and fill it with cubes.
    2. Add the tomato juice, and fresh lemon juice.
    3. Make sure to season with black and hot sauce as well.
    4. Stir well.
    5. Make sure to garnish with a celery stick and lemon wedge.

The Virgin Mary is a savory and spicy delight. It’s ideal for people who appreciate a little spice in their cocktails, but without the alcohol.

1. Infusing Flavors

  • bottles for infusion: Look into investing Infusion bottles or jars. They can help you incorporate various flavors in your cocktails, including herbs and spices to fruits and vegetables. Simply add your preferred ingredients and let them infuse for the most unique twist on classic recipes.

  • Cold Brew Tea: Cold-brewed teas can provide layers of complexity and depth to your cocktail. Try different varieties of tea such as chamomile, hibiscus or earl grey. Make use of these as a base or flavour enhancer for your drinks.


2. the Art of Layering

  • Layering Tools: Create stunning cocktails with layers, invest in bar equipment like a bar spoon with a spiral handle and a steady grip. Slowly pour each drink over the back of the spoon to create distinct layers.

  • Density It’s important to Make sure you know the density of your ingredients. For heavier ingredients like syrups, should be placed at the lower part of the stack, while lighter ones like juices or sodas, should go above.


3. Smoke and Mirrors

  • Smoking Gun: Add a dimension and mystery to your drinks, consider smoking guns. This gadget enlivens your drinks with aromas of smoke. Experiment with different herbs and wood chips to create distinctive flavors.

  • Smoking Glass: For a simpler method, you can smoke the glass directly. Cover the glass by a lid or coaster and introduce smoke underneath. Once you remove the cover your guests will be received by a pleasant aroma.


4. Garnish with Flair

  • Edible Flowers: The edible flowers such as pansies, violets, and Nasturtiums look gorgeous but they also provide subtle, floral notes to your cocktails. Ensure they are pesticide-free and safe for consumption.

  • Citrus Zest: Make your garnishing more appealing by using citrus zest in an innovative way. Make long, spiraled twists of orange or lemon peels to bring a splash of citrus scent to your beverages.

Essential Garnishing Techniques

Let’s take a look at some crucial garnishing tips that will make your mocktails go to the next degree:

1. Citrus Twists And Zests

Citrus twists and zests are diverse garnishes to add an unexpected flavor and aroma. For a twist, use a peeler for citrus to cut a thin strip of peel, twist it over that drink so it releases oils to then drop it into. Zest, which is the grated outer layer made of citrus peels, can be sprinkled on top of the mocktail.

2. Herbs as well Edible Flowers

Fresh herbs such as mint rosemary, basil or even mint can add flavor and appearance for your mocktail. Carefully slap or tap the herb before garnishing to let their essential oils release. Edible flowers not only look beautiful but also add a touch of elegance.

3. Fruit Slices and Skewers

Fruit garnishes such as citrus wheel, berries, or slices of a pineapple can provide an explosion of color and flavor. Skewering them onto straws or cocktail sticks adds a fun and practical aspect.

4. Salt and Sugar Rims

Rimming the glass by adding sugar or salt to the glass adds a unique twist to your mocktail. Wet the rim with the citrus wedge, and then put it into a bowl of salt or sugar to make a beautiful edge.

5. Bits, Tinctures and Bitters

A few drops of aromatic bitters or flavored liquids that are placed on top of your drink can give it beautiful marbling effects, which boost the flavor.

The importance of presentation

Beyond garnishes to the way they are served can have a profound impact on the taste:

1. The Glassware Collection

Glassware should complement the drink. Tall glasses for highballs and stemware for elegant cocktails and mason jars for rustic look.

2. Ice and chill

Make use of clear, high-quality ice cubes or spheres to keep your mocktail cold without adding any flavor. It is also possible to freeze edible fruits and flowers into ice cubes to add some flair.

3. Layering and Pouring Techniques

You can experiment with layering methods to create visually stunning mocktails. Pouring slowly over the back of a spoon can help you separate liquids for the appearance of a layer.

4. Garnish Placing

Place the garnishes where they belong. As an example, a sprig of rosemary could be tall when placed in the glass of a height, while a citrus twist may gently drape over the rim.

Notable Alcohol-Free Spirit Brands in Europe

Let’s get into a few of the top alcohol-free companies that are taking Europe by storm:

1. Seedlip

about Seedlip: Seedlip is often credited with being the pioneer of an alcohol-free movement. They have a range of distilled spirits without alcohol that feature intricate botanical profile.


Primary Products

  • Seedlip Garden 108 One of the most vibrant and herbaceous blend with notes of hay and peas.
  • Seedlip Spice 1994: Rich and aromatic This blend includes allspice (allspice), cardamom, and oak.

2. Lyre’s

What is Lyre’s? Lyre’s are renowned for its huge selection of alcohol-free spirits that resemble the tastes of classic alcoholic beverages.


Main Products:

  • Lyre’s Dry London Spirit: A non-alcoholic, gin with juniper as well as citrus notes.
  • Lyre’s American Malt: Emulates the rich flavors of American Bourbon.

3. Ritual Zero Proof

Information about Ritual Zeroproof: Ritual has a large assortment of alcohol-free alternatives that are created to recreate the flavor or mouthfeel typical of spirits.


The Key Product:

  • Ritual Whiskey Replacement: offers vanilla, oak and caramel notes but without the alcohol.
  • Ritual Gin Alternative: A botanical blend that has juniper and cucumber undertones.
